91 drivers who used emergency lane, to be charged in court

Road Transport Department (RTD) director-general Datuk Seri Ismail Ahmad yesterday said enforcement action is proceeding against 91 vehicle owners identified using the emergency lane at KM228 of the North-South Expressway near Malacca last month – preventing the passage of an ambulance and resulting in an accident victim dying.

So far, Ismail said following seven drivers had given their statements to the RTD and will be charged in court.

He reiterated that the RTD will not compromise and will bring to court immediately road users who use emergency lanes illegally.

Ismail said for those who are adamant in using the emergency lanes will be brought to court under Rule 9 and 53 of Road Traffic Rules 1959 that carries a fine of not more than RM2,000 or jail not less then a year.

“Previously, we imposed a fine of RM300 for the offence but found that the fine was too low to give any effect to the offenders.

“To show the severity of the matter, we have taken legal action that will enable them to be imposed a maximum fine of RM2,000 or jail for a year.”
